Output d04c12d09378ca281a1ef995b90f4fa11416b42886b99a77b4c779b6845867e4:1

value
3199985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46f4f541388d8b2995fc16aeeff93cefe22f433a OP_EQUAL
address
38ACfxHJwKnKFW2Evmnk58Aj9CBF7t3T88
transaction
d04c12d09378ca281a1ef995b90f4fa11416b42886b99a77b4c779b6845867e4
confirmations
57642
spent
true